Hi Roger,
"I have been receiving errors when trying to open my NAS after not using it for a while after logging on to Windows 8.1"
Do you mean it can be accessed before ?
Please try to following command line to disable the autodisconnect feature to have a check.
"net config server /autodisconnect:-1"
Here is a link for reference :
Mapped Drive Connection to Network Share May Be Lost
http://support.microsoft.com/en-us/kb/297684
We also need to change the power option of the network adapter.
Open Device Manager to change the power management settings for a network adapter. To disable this setting in Device Manager, expand “Network Adapters”, right-click the adapter, click “Properties”, click the “Power Management “tab, and then clear the “Allow
the computer to turn off this device to save power” check box.
If there is any antivirus software installed ,please turn them off temporarily to have a check .
Please also check the status of these services "Workstation, DHCP Client, DNS Client, Server, TCP/IP Netbios helper, Computer Browser".

Go to Solution.Turn Off IPv6 Support in Vista
Go to Network Connections folder (click on Start button, then right click on Network, select Properties, then click on “Manager network connections” on Tasks pane).
You should see various LAN, wireless, Bluetooth, high speed Internet, and other network connections available on the Vista computer with the network adapter description. Right click on the network connection that you want to disable the IPv6 interface and select “Properties”.
Click “Continue” on User Access Control permission request prompt.
Clear the check box next to the Internet Protocol version 6 (TCP/IPv6) component in the list under “This connection uses the following items” box.
Click OK when done.

Symptom: The network connection drops unexpectedly
Your Mac may not not stay connected to your Wi-Fi network reliably.
Your Mac may stop accessing the Internet during use.
Solution
Use these steps if your computer disconnects from its Wi-Fi network unexpectedly.
Check your range to the Wi-Fi router and reduce the effect of interference.If your computer is too far from your Wi-Fi router or your environment has too much Wi-Fi interference, then your computer may not detect the Wi-Fi network properly. The easiest way to check for range limits with your Wi-Fi network is to move your computer or your Wi-Fi router closer together and make sure that there are no obstructions (such as walls, cabinets, and so forth) between the router and your computer.See Potential sources of wireless interference for more information about interference and solutions.
Try connecting to a different Wi-Fi network. If your computer works fine when connected to a different Wi-Fi network, then the issue may be related to your network router or ISP. In that case, contact the manufacturer of your router or your ISP.

It's driving me crazy!Thanks for the clarification Angus,
Try disabling the Auto Off feature, this current configuration actually turns the printer Off after 5 minutes idle (Any key pressing will turn the printer On, but any remote command as printing or accessing the printer page will fail..
You may enter the EWS by entering the printer IP through Safari.
Enter the Settings tab.
Select Print Settings and turn the Auto Off after as Never.
Click Apply and reboot the device, then check for any change.
